Respiratory Therapist pay in New Hampshire, explained

Respiratory therapists in New Hampshire earn a median of $95,940 per year ($46.13 per hour), which is 17% above the national median of $82,280. Entry-level workers earn around $80,490, while the most experienced respiratory therapists reach about $109,000. Pay varies by employer, setting, and metro area within New Hampshire.

Is $95,940 good pay in New Hampshire?

Adjusted for New Hampshire's cost of living (which runs 104% of the U.S. average), that $95,940 is worth about $92,104 in national buying power — ranking New Hampshire #10 for real pay (vs #10 on the sticker number).
